Theoretical aspects of oxidation of composite materials
Ge WangDepartment of Materials Science and Engineering, The Ohio State University, Columbus, OH 43210, U.S.A.
Abstract
Relationships between the high-temperature oxidation behavior and the composite
architecture (shape, size, volume fraction, and orientation of the reinforcement phase) are
proposed.
